Climate for Development in Africa (ClimDev Africa)
The Climate for Development in Africa Programme is an integrated, multi-partner programme addressing climate observations, climate services, climate risk management, and climate policy needs in Africa. The user-driven programme will support efforts to achieve the Millennium Development Goals. In addition to GCOS, principal partners are the UN Economic Commission for Africa, the African Union, the African Development Bank, the World Meteorological Organization, and potential donors including the UK Department for International Development.
